Gather Relevant Documents



Before meeting with your defense attorney, it's essential to gather all pertinent papers referring to your case. This consists of any kind of apprehension documents, court notices, bail documents, and other legal files you've obtained. Collecting these documents doesn't simply help your legal representative understand the specifics of your scenario; it additionally shows you're aggressive and engaged, which can just help your instance.



You should additionally bring any kind of evidence that could support your defense. If there's anything in your ownership that negates the fees against you or places events in a different light, see to it to have it accessible.

Do not overlook your personal records either. Points like your employment history, financial info, and prior communication with any engaged parties can occasionally provide beneficial context for your defense strategy.

Lastly, organize these papers in a clear, organized method. Maybe make use of a folder or binder with labeled sections to make whatever conveniently accessible. This company will conserve you and your legal representative valuable time and let you concentrate on discussing your defense rather than looking for paperwork.

Prepare Your Inquiries



Once you have actually arranged your records, it's critical to prepare a checklist of concerns for your defense lawyer. This action ensures you're completely prepared and can take advantage of the time during your preliminary assessment.

Begin by writing down any kind of concerns or specifics regarding your instance that you don't recognize. Inquire about their experience in managing instances comparable to your own. You'll would like to know how familiar they're with your kind of lawful concern. This can provide you insight into their expertise and prospective approach techniques.

Don't forget to inquire about the feasible results of your situation. Comprehending what to anticipate can help you support for the upcoming legal trip.

It's also important to ask about who else may service your case. Will various other lawyers or paralegals be involved? Recognizing the team aids you comprehend the support system and who you may be communicating with.

Lastly, think about inquiring about what you can do to aid your case. This reveals your willingness to be involved and can foster a collaborative relationship.

Understand Legal Charges and Procedures



Comprehending the lawful costs and processes included is important as you prepare to deal with your defense attorney. It's vital that you get a clear picture of just how billing works, which can differ substantially from one attorney to an additional. Generally, defense attorneys bill either a flat fee or by the hour. Ask your attorney for a detailed description of their payment technique so there are no surprises in the future.

You'll additionally require to understand the retainer cost, which is an ahead of time price that serves as a deposit on future solutions. This fee is commonly non-refundable, so you need to recognize precisely what it covers.

Do not be reluctant to ask about extra prices like court costs, management costs, and costs for outdoors experts, which can add up promptly.

As for the legal process, you're entitled to know the actions involved in your protection strategy. This consists of initial hearings, pre-trial movements, possible appeal deals, and the trial itself. Each phase has its own complexities and timelines.

Make certain your attorney describes each stage, what your duty will certainly be, and how you can plan for each action. Being educated assists you manage expectations and adds to a smoother lawful journey.
